Pediatrix Medical Group seeks a Neonatologist to join its well-established practice in covering Tampa, Plant City and the surrounding areas.

  • This position will primarily cover the NICU at South Florida Baptist Hospital in Plant City, with the opportunity to rotate through the 76-bed Level-IV NICU at St Joseph Women's Hospital in Tampa
  • Schedule will consist of daytime rounding and evening call from home
  • Must live in a 30 minute response time from South Florida Baptist Hospital in Plant City
  • The group provides 24 hour in-house delivery room and newborn coverage at hospitals within the Baycare System
  • The neonatologists provide in-house call at St. Joseph's Women's Hospital Level-IV NICU, and a combination of in-house and back-up call from home for the other NICUs with either a Neo or NNP providing night coverage
  • A combination of neonatologists and pediatricians provide normal newborn coverage at the hospitals
  • The team consists of 16 neonatologists, 5 neonatal hospitalists and 14 NNPs who provide care to patients in Hillsborough and Pinellas counties

About Us:


Pediatrix Medical Group is one of the nation s leading providers of highly specialized health care for women, babies and children. Since 1979, Pediatrix has grown from a single neonatology practice to a national, multispecialty medical group. Pediatrix-affiliated clinicians are committed to providing coordinated, compassionate and clinically excellent services to women, babies and children across the continuum of care, both in hospital settings and office-based practices. The group s high-quality, evidence-based care is bolstered by significant investments in research, education, quality-improvement and safety initiatives.
